

The Tyttöjen taksi (Taxi for Girls) initiative addresses the concern of personal safety during nighttime journeys, with a focus on empowering women to feel secure while traveling alone.
- Finland
- Influencer & Media Events
The goal of Tyttöjen taksi (Taxi for Girls) was to draw attention to the issue of personal safety and offer a secure journey home, particularly for women. The challenge was to collaborate effectively and create a responsible event that would ensure safety and make a lasting impression.
Through a collaborative effort between Drama Queen, Neste K, Valopilkku, LIWLIG, Takana's security services, Royals' event staff, and Framme's production expertise, Tyttöjen taksi (Taxi for Girls) provided a safe transportation service. It demonstrated responsibility beyond environmental considerations and highlighted the importance of personal safety.
Tyttöjen taksi (Taxi for Girls) offered a secure ride to nearly 70 individuals traveling alone, creating awareness and positively impacting the community. The event emphasized the significance of the cause, both through media attention and the achievement of the set goals in terms of the number of rides provided.
Result/Impact
- Delivered safe rides to nearly 70 individuals traveling alone - Raised awareness and sparked conversations among city-dwellers - Promoted the importance of personal safety through successful execution
